Transaction 3177ba6e9384adbb23e1aac61d43fe2434277fb3589c83c157ca54a973f005fe
1 Input
1 Output
-
3177ba6e9384adbb23e1aac61d43fe2434277fb3589c83c157ca54a973f005fe:0
- value
- 880414
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bde4608c15f098811fa012174a72ee4b0d1f04a4 OP_EQUAL
- address
- 3K15Dio3y3VfyCJ7uorJDgk48c9GBr3D1L